Output e80a4fabeb86a50ebbeebd16ff637b08371c8b98921932c85eb47de56c19c6fe:0

value
1407229
script pubkey
OP_0 OP_PUSHBYTES_20 05a3d5cf9f569544196f0158ca1c2c99576ef8fb
address
bc1qqk3atnul2625gxt0q9vv58pvn9tka78mmjesan
transaction
e80a4fabeb86a50ebbeebd16ff637b08371c8b98921932c85eb47de56c19c6fe
confirmations
298559
spent
true